Vehicles imported by nonresidents

Non-residents wishing to import their own vehicles must ensure they have all the documents needed to avoid additional charges. Documentation includes the bill-of-lading, certification of origin and other legal documents related to the vehicle. In addition all documents related to the vehicle must be in English. If the vehicle is jointly owned by multiple people, each signature needs to be notarized. A black-and-white copy of the driver's license or ID card should also accompany it. If they don't possess these documents, a Power of Attorney can be used to sign the necessary documents.

To be legally titled, an imported vehicle must be in compliance with the Department of Transportation's (DOT) and Environmental Protection Agency's (EPA) regulations. Particularly DOT standards require that motor vehicle claim vehicles less than 25 years old adhere to safety and bumper standards and that the producer of each automobile must place a label on each such vehicle that indicates that it is in compliance with these standards.

EPA regulations also require that all vehicles comply with standards for air pollution emission. If a nonresident wishes to import a vehicle that does not meet the requirements, they'll have to submit EPA form HS-7 and DOT form 3520-1 with CBP to get prior approval from EPA.

Imported Touring Vehicles

Motorists traveling to the United States as tourists from Central and South American countries which have signed the Inter-American Convention of 1943 may use their vehicles in the United States for one year or the period of validity of their documents or less and without needing to get license plates or driver's licenses. However, they have to present EPA forms AP 3520-1 and DOT HS-7 at the time of entry.

Automobiles imported for tourism purposes are also subject to a 40% Customs duty as well as 10% VAT and ad valorem taxes ranging from 15% to 100% depending on the displacement of the piston using their book value as a base. These taxes and duties apply to spare parts shipped with the vehicle imported. The presence of the owner of the vehicle is essential.
